What Is Semaglutide Injection?
Semaglutide is a GLP-1 receptor agonist. That means it mimics a natural hormone in the body called glucagon-like peptide-1, which helps regulate blood sugar and appetite.
Medical Uses
The FDA has approved Semaglutide for two primary uses:
- Type 2 Diabetes: Helps lower blood sugar and A1C levels.
- Chronic Weight Management: Assists with weight loss in people with obesity or overweight conditions.
Forms of Semaglutide
Semaglutide comes in a few brand-name options:
- Ozempic: Weekly injection for type 2 diabetes.
- Wegovy: Weekly injection for weight loss.
- Rybelsus: Oral tablet version for type 2 diabetes.
Each form has different strengths and dosing, so talk with your healthcare provider to find the right option for your needs.
How Semaglutide Works in the Body
The secret to Semaglutide's success lies in how it affects digestion, appetite, and insulin production.
Appetite Control
Semaglutide activates GLP-1 receptors in the brain and digestive system. This reduces hunger and slows gastric emptying, meaning you feel full longer and eat less.
Blood Sugar Regulation
By increasing insulin production (only when blood sugar is elevated) and decreasing glucagon release, Semaglutide helps stabilize blood sugar without the risk of extreme lows in most people.
Weight Loss Support
Most users experience significant weight loss because of reduced calorie intake and better portion control. In clinical trials, some patients lost 10 to 15 percent of their body weight.

Who Should Take Semaglutide?
Semaglutide is not a one-size-fits-all solution, but it is an excellent option for many individuals.
Ideal Candidates
- Adults with type 2 diabetes needing better glucose control
- Adults with a BMI of 27 or higher and weight-related health issues
- Individuals struggling with obesity who have tried other methods without success
Who Should Avoid It
-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als
- Those with a history of thyroid tumors or pancreatitis
- Anyone with severe gastrointestinal disorders

Side Effects and Risks
Like any medication, Semaglutide comes with potential side effects. Most are manageable, especially with proper guidance.
Common Side Effects
- Nausea
- Diarrhea
- Constipation
- Loss of appetite
- Fatigue or lightheadedness
These symptoms often decrease after the first few weeks as your body adjusts.
Rare but Serious Risks
- Pancreatitis
- Gallbladder issues
- Kidney problems
- Thyroid tumors (in people with a history of medullary thyroid carcinoma)
If you notice severe abdominal pain or unusual symptoms, contact your healthcare provider right away.
Managing Side Effects
- Start with a low dose and increase gradually
- Eat smaller meals throughout the day
- Stay hydrated
- Avoid greasy or rich foods in the beginning
